What is Advanced Calculus?

Advanced Calculus is a rigorous extension of single-variable calculus, focusing on precise definitions of limits, continuity, differentiation, and integration. Students explore proofs, theorems, and real analysis methods that underpin modern mathematics. It deepens understanding of convergence, infinite series, and establishes a foundation for functional analysis. Applications appear in physics and engineering.

Some colleges call it Analysis I or Real Analysis. In engineering faculties it’s often dubbed Calculus III. Others see it as Advanced Mathematical Analysis or simply Advanced Engineering Mathematics. The naming varies but the core remains limits, proofs and higher-dimensional thought.

Core topics include sequences and series of functions, uniform convergence and power series expansions. Students prove the MVT (Mean Value Theorem) and explore the FTC (Fundamental Theorem of Calculus) with rigorous epsilon-delta methods. Multivariable extensions cover partial derivatives, gradients, divergence, curl, line and surface integrals in vector fields, plus Green’s, Stokes’ and the Divergence Theorem. Real-world examples pop up all the time: computing work done by a force field along a pipe or optimizing fuel efficiency in dynamic systems. Fourier series and orthogonal functions round out the curriculum, bridging to differential equations and signal processing.

Advanced Calculus traces back to Archimedes around 200 BC, who used the method of exhaustion to find areas under curves. In the late 1600s, Newton and Leibniz independently invented calculus with infinitesimals for physics and astronomy problems. By 1821 Cauchy introduced rigorous definitions of limit and continuity. Later in the 19th century, Weierstrass replaced intuitive infinitesimals with formal epsilon-delta proofs, and Riemann developed his integral. Henri Lebesgue’s 1904 revolution in measure theory expanded integration to more functions. Twentieth-century advances in functional analysis, spearheaded by Hilbert and Banach, built on these foundations. Its impact were huge, fueling modern physics, engineering and economics.

What is so special about Advanced Calculus?

Advanced Calculus stands out by diving deeper into the ideas of limits, continuity, and derivatives with a sharp focus on precise proofs. It extends basic calculus to multiple variables, infinite series, and vector fields, offering a clear view of the hidden patterns in curves and surfaces. This level of detail builds strong critical thinking and lays a solid foundation for higher math.

Compared to other math subjects, Advanced Calculus gives you powerful tools for solving real‑world problems in physics, engineering, and computer science by explaining why methods work, not just how. Its strong emphasis on proofs and theory boosts logical skills, but can feel abstract and tough to follow at first. Students often need extra time and practice to master its rigorous challenges.

What are the career opportunities in Advanced Calculus?

Students who finish advanced calculus often move on to graduate studies in pure or applied mathematics, physics, or engineering. They study real and functional analysis, partial differential equations, or numerical methods. Lately, many also explore computational math and data-driven modeling.

In the job market, advanced calculus skills lead to roles like quantitative analyst, data scientist, algorithm developer, or research engineer. These jobs involve building mathematical models, analyzing large data sets, designing numerical algorithms, and solving complex real‑world problems in finance, tech, or engineering firms.

We study and prepare for advanced calculus tests to build strong problem‑solving skills, logical thinking, and mathematical rigor. Test prep also boosts confidence for exams like the GRE Math Subject Test or PhD qualifying exams and helps in technical job interviews.

Advanced calculus finds use in physics simulations, engineering design, machine learning, computer graphics, and optimization. Its tools let us model changing systems, predict outcomes, and create precise algorithms, making it a core skill in science and technology today.

How to learn Advanced Calculus?

Start by mapping out the key topics like multivariable limits, partial derivatives, multiple integrals and vector calculus. Gather a clear textbook, set daily goals, read one section at a time, then work through example problems. After each topic, do practice exercises, check solutions, and revisit any mistakes. Gradually move to tougher problems and past exam papers. Keep notes of tricky steps and review them each week to build confidence and retention.

Advanced Calculus can feel challenging because it goes deeper into theory and proofs. If you’ve mastered single-variable calculus and linear algebra, you’ll find it much easier. Patience and regular practice turn hard topics into familiar ones. Most students overcome the steepest parts by solving many problems and discussing ideas with peers or a mentor.

You can self-study using books and online lectures, but having a tutor speeds up your learning. A tutor spots gaps in your understanding, answers questions in real time, and keeps you motivated. If you prefer structured guidance, a tutor’s support is very helpful, especially when you hit tough proof-based questions or complex integrals.

On average, dedicated study for Advanced Calculus takes about 3–6 months if you spend an hour or two each weekday. If you’re already strong in calculus basics, you might finish sooner. Students new to proofs or multivariable topics may need closer to six months. Consistency beats cramming: steady daily practice leads to the best results.

Here are some top resources: YouTube: 3Blue1Brown’s “Essence of Calculus”, MIT OpenCourseWare Calculus, Professor Leonard’s lectures. Websites: Khan Academy (khanacademy.org/math/multivariable-calculus), Paul’s Online Math Notes (tutorial.math.lamar.edu). Books: “Calculus” by Michael Spivak, “Advanced Calculus” by Patrick M. Fitzpatrick, “Calculus, Vol. 2” by Tom Apostol.
